Technical Features & Benefits
Our product is the right mix of good looks and usefulness. The structure of the tight grains makes the wood very stable, so it doesn't bend or cup. Birch flooring is very durable, with a Janka hardness rating of 1260 lbf. It is great for places that get a lot of foot traffic.
Birch's light color makes it easy to stain in a variety of ways, so you can get the look you want for any job. Our choices that are already finished have a long-lasting aluminum oxide finish that makes them less likely to scratch or stain. If you'd rather finish your project yourself, our unfinished planks give you the most options for customizing.

Cleaning & Maintenance
Maintaining product is straightforward:
- Regular sweeping or vacuuming to remove dirt and debris
- Damp mopping with a pH-neutral cleaner for deeper cleaning
- Prompt cleaning of spills to prevent staining
- Use of felt pads under furniture to prevent scratches
- Periodic refinishing to restore the floor's original luster
